Transportation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Arizona
Arizona's transportation sector spans logistics hubs in Phoenix and Tucson, freight rail networks, and port-of-entry operations along the Mexico border. Major employers like Arizona Department of Transportation, Southwest Airlines (with headquarters in Phoenix), and Union Pacific Railroad actively sponsor H-1B visa, TN visa, and L-1 visas for engineering, operations management, and logistics coordination roles.

Which transportation companies sponsor visas in Arizona?
Arizona Department of Transportation leads state-level sponsorship, while Southwest Airlines sponsors for aviation roles at Sky Harbor. Union Pacific and BNSF Railway sponsor for rail operations and engineering positions. FedEx and UPS sponsor at their Phoenix and Tucson distribution centers. Knight-Swift Transportation, headquartered in Phoenix, sponsors for logistics technology and operations management roles.

Which visa types are most common for transportation roles in Arizona?
H-1B visas dominate for transportation engineering, logistics analysis, and operations management positions requiring specialized knowledge. TN visas work well for Canadian and Mexican professionals in engineering and logistics roles. L-1 visas are common for managers transferring to Arizona offices of multinational transportation companies like FedEx or international rail operators.
Which cities in Arizona have the most transportation sponsorship jobs?
Phoenix leads with Sky Harbor International Airport, major rail yards, and distribution centers for national carriers. The Phoenix metropolitan area hosts Southwest Airlines headquarters and regional offices for Union Pacific and BNSF Railway. Tucson follows with Raytheon aerospace operations and cross-border logistics companies. Flagstaff offers some rail and logistics positions along Interstate 40.
What are the prevailing wage considerations for transportation jobs in Arizona?
Arizona transportation prevailing wages vary significantly by role and location. Phoenix metropolitan area commands higher wages for aviation and logistics management positions compared to rural areas. Border logistics roles in Nogales and Yuma may have different wage determinations. Rail engineering positions typically meet H-1B wage requirements more easily than entry-level logistics coordination roles.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ored transportation jobs in Arizona?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
